Middlesbrough's frustrating season continued last night as they lost out to Bournemouth at the Vitality Stadium in the EFL Cup.

The men from the Riverside Stadium have not had a good campaign so far this year and, though they were expected to get into the top six at the very least, they look as though they are short on confidence right now. Garry Monk, then, is the man tasked with finding a solution for the club and it remains to be seen whether or not he can find it.

One possible lifeline appeared to emerge last night, though, as young Marcus Tavernier showed all the fearlessness you need to turn around a slump with his fine goal offering the Teessiders a real foothold in the tie.

Of course, they couldn't hold on but the hope around Tavernier will only increase and it'll be interesting to see if he features at the weekend.
